Crete Property Buying Process

STEP 1 : : :


Having decided to buy your new home in Crete your first step will be to appoint a lawyer to act for and on your behalf.

The Lawyer

  • Your chosen lawyer (who we can introduce you to) will explain the legal side of buying in Greece.
  • Your lawyer will accompany you to a Public Notary (a government appointed body) where you will pay approx. €50 and complete the documents required to give the lawyer Power of Attorney to represent you in this purchase.
  • Your lawyer will then be able to open a local bank account for you in joint names to allow you to transfer money from your home country to Crete to finance your purchase. Your lawyer will then be able to forward the stage payments to the builder when you request her to do so..
  • Furthermore your lawyer - once given Power of Attorney - will then obtain your local tax number for you (known as A.Fee.Mee Number) This number is required by law to be able to purchase property in Greece.
  • Your lawyer's fees will be paid separately to him/her by you at Land stage of the Buying Land stage of the Buying Process, i.e. 40% stage (stages 1 and 2 together). These fees also include the purchase tax - the only tax liable on your new home. Once the purchase tax is paid there are no further tax liabilities on your new home in Greece. There is no Capital Gains Tax in Greece.

    Stage Payments : : : 10% Deposit
    30% Land purchase
    30% 1st construction
    30% less €1000 - 2nd construction
    €1000 Hand over of keys

  • Your lawyer will also be able to sign all purchase documents on your behalf and in your absence.
  • All paperwork with the lawyer and visit to the Public Notary is concluded in approximately one hour.

    STEP 2 : : :

  • You will receive a Sales Confirmation letter from New Century – Constructions/ Real Estate, confirming the price of your new home and breaking down the stage payments and detailing what you are paying for at each stage.

    STEP 3 : : :
  • A specification sheet should be completed before you leave Crete.
    This is a breakdown of any extras that you would like to add to your new home, i.e. solar panel, central heating, water deposit tank, and also detailing colours of wood to be used and tile orders from local stockists for future reference by New Century.

    STEP 4 : : :
  • 10% Deposit.
    When you have returned home your lawyer will inform you of the details of the account that she has opened for you so that you can transfer your 10% deposit. We will inform you of all monies received and you will be sent requests for future stage payments as and when required.
  • 30% - Land Purchase
    This stage payment is also required pretty much as soon as you return home. At this point your will be registered in the local Land Registry and titles will be signed for by your lawyer. By Law at this time anything then built on the land is legally yours.
  • 30% - 1st Construction
    You will be requested to forward this money at the stage that the frame of the house has been built. It is our policy that you should see the work in progress on your new building before you start to pay for it.
  • 30% - 2nd Construction - less €1000
    Again this money will be requested at a time appropriate to the works being done in your new home. This money should be sent when all bricking up and plastering has been finished and New Century has started your fixtures and fittings in your new home.
  • € 1000
    You will be expected to pay this at hand over of keys. As soon as is possible we request that you check through your new home and advise us of any outstanding items or problems that you may come across.

Also at 2nd construction stage and near the finishing of the building - if you have ordered electrical goods and furniture - New Century will endeavour to have these delivered and installed before you arrive.
